Comparison review

Samsung Galaxy Note 5 is a bit better than Motorola Moto G51 5G, getting a general score of 79.3 against 77.8. The Samsung Galaxy Note 5 is an much older cellphone than Motorola Moto G51 5G, but it is thinner and lighter anyway. These phones work with Android OS, but Samsung Galaxy Note 5 has the older 5.1 version and Motorola Moto G51 5G has Android 11.

The Galaxy Note 5 has a better looking display than Motorola Moto G51 5G, because although it has a bit smaller screen, it also counts with a better 2560 x 1440 resolution and more pixels per screen inch. Motorola Moto G51 5G has a little better hardware performance than Samsung Galaxy Note 5, and although they both have 4 GB of RAM, the Motorola Moto G51 5G also has a greater number of cores (although they are slower).

Motorola Moto G51 5G has a superior camera than Galaxy Note 5, and although they both have the same 1920x1080 (Full HD) video quality, the Motorola Moto G51 5G also has a bigger aperture to capture better photography and videos in low-light environments, faster video frame rate and a much more mega pixels camera.

Motorola Moto G51 5G features a way bigger memory capacity for applications and games than Samsung Galaxy Note 5, and although they both have exactly the same internal storage capacity, the Motorola Moto G51 5G also has a slot for an SD memory card that holds a maximum of 512 GB. Moto G51 5G has a superior battery life than Galaxy Note 5, because it has a 5000mAh battery capacity instead of 3000mAh.
